Integration of AI Agents in Business Operations
Companies are increasingly embedding AI agents into their workflows to enhance productivity and efficiency. For instance, Shopify’s CEO, Tobi Lütke, has mandated that managers must demonstrate that AI cannot perform a job before hiring new employees. This policy underscores the company’s commitment to integrating AI into daily operations, with performance reviews now evaluating employees on their effective use of AI tools. This strategic shift aims to leverage AI to boost overall efficiency and innovation, positioning Shopify at the forefront of AI adoption in e-commerce.
Similarly, Microsoft is enhancing its AI assistant, Copilot, to provide more proactive and personalized support. The updated Copilot can remember user-specific details to offer tailored assistance, such as reminders and recommendations, reflecting a broader industry trend toward creating AI agents that form lasting, meaningful relationships with users. This development signifies a move toward AI systems that not only assist but also adapt to individual user needs, thereby improving user engagement and satisfaction.
Advancements in AI Agent Capabilities
The capabilities of AI agents are advancing rapidly, enabling them to handle more complex tasks autonomously. Researchers from Nvidia, Google, and Foundry have introduced Ember, an open-source framework designed to address the issue of “overthinking” in AI reasoning models. Ember orchestrates interactions among different AI models with varying reasoning strengths and response times, optimizing performance by breaking down complex prompts into smaller tasks routed to the most suitable AI agents. This approach enhances the efficiency and accuracy of AI systems, paving the way for more reliable and effective AI agents.
In the realm of personal AI companions, Mustafa Suleyman, CEO of Microsoft’s AI division, envisions AI agents that adapt to individual users, complete with names, styles, and potentially animated avatars. These companions aim to form lasting relationships with users by remembering interactions and assisting in daily tasks, representing a significant shift toward more personalized and interactive AI experiences.
Emergence of AI Agents in Security Operations
AI agents are also making significant strides in cybersecurity. Agentic AI transforms Security Operations Centers (SOCs) by autonomously triaging and investigating alerts, reducing analyst fatigue, and improving detection speed. Unlike traditional AI tools that function as assistants, Agentic AI systems independently perceive, plan, investigate, and conclude, acting much like skilled analysts. This autonomy allows for instant triage at scale, deep and consistent investigations, and better prioritization of threats, ultimately enhancing the overall efficiency and effectiveness of security operations.
Challenges and Considerations
Despite the promising advancements, the widespread adoption of AI agents presents challenges. A recent Pew Research Center report highlights a significant trust gap between AI experts and the general public. While nearly 75% of AI experts are optimistic about the technology’s benefits, only a quarter of the public shares that sentiment. Concerns about job displacement and a lack of trust in both governmental and corporate oversight of AI persist, underscoring the need for transparent and responsible AI development and implementation.
Furthermore, as AI agents become more integrated into critical operations, they emerge as potential targets for cyberattacks. Digital entities such as bots and AI agents pose a growing cybersecurity risk for enterprises, necessitating robust security measures to protect these systems from exploitation.
